  • Bellagio (Pass by)

    Next stop is Bellagio, known for its cobbled streets, elegant buildings and Villa Serbelloni Park, an 18th-century garden terrace overlooking the lake. Nearby, there are the Tower of the Arts, home to exhibitions and shows, and the Basilica of St. James from the Romanesque era. Near the rocky beach of Loppia, there is the Museum of Navigational Instruments, which displays sundials and compasses. With the 4-hour tour you can get off and visit the village.

  • I Giardini Di Villa Melzi (Pass by)

    The English gardens of 1815, enriched by sculptures rich in rare and exotic plants, there are ancient trees, camellia hedges, forests of azaleas and giant rhododendrons, stones and monuments, boats and relics of historical and artistic value.

  • (Pass by)

    Ossuccio is a village of pre-Roman origin. In its hamlet of Ospedaletto rises the famous bell tower of the church of Santa Maria Maddalena. in front of the village is the Comacina island

    Admission ticket free
  • Isola Comacina (Pass by)

    The only island on Lake Como, in its canal hosts, in summer, swimmers who want to cool off with a swim in the lake. It is possible to swim safely.

  • Orrido Di Nesso (Pass by)

    We will then be able to admire the ravine of Nesso, a natural waterfall that in the terminal part is overlooked by the bridge of Civera

    Admission ticket free
  • (Pass by)

    The Civera bridge, a Roman bridge rebuilt with a medieval silhouette from which tourists love to dive for incredible shots.
